There is a cutout switch that turns off the fan when the cover is closed.
That switch goes bad sometimes.
This happens to mine every once in a while, that pin switch sticks or has enough dirt and corrosion on it so it does not make contact. All I have to do to un-stick it is open and close the lid manually a couple inches a few times and it starts working again.
If that does not work, if you remove the screen, feel around for the switch and push it up and down a few times. Make sure to turn the fan off first :E
